bush needs to point out to people they will have limited options like they do now in a 401k program or federal program. they will only be able to buy into three or four programmed conservative choices.. they will not be playing in the market.


If private accounts as either a carve out or add on is the
correct solution .. why not merely enable the Trustees of
the SS Trust Fund to make the appropriate investments with
that portion of the payroll taxes that will eventually (?)
be earmarked for private accounts ?? .. Wouldn't cost much
to administer within the Treasury Dept vs the cost of creating and
administering millions of private accounts for individual taxpayers ..
